Moms Go Running

This evening, after Caleb had gone to bed, I found Norah in the kitchen getting two cups of water from the fridge.  On the counter, she'd already gotten out a bag of microwave popcorn and "the popcorn bowl." 

"What are you doing?" I asked her.

"I'm getting water and popcorn ready for Daddy and me," she told me, continuing with: "We're gonna play cards, eat popcorn, and watch some TV."

"You are?  Well, that sounds like fun," I told her.  "But what about me?  What's Mom gonna do?"

"Ummm," she paused before saying, "You're gonna go running."

True dat.



I stuck around for 2 hands of Old Maid, and then I changed and headed out for my 4 miler.

Since I'd been home all day with the kidlets, and was feeling a little worn, it sure was tempting to hang out at home, watch some "Annie," and munch on some popcorn, but I always know that a run will serve me better.

So, I left them to their Daddy-Daughter time, and 40 minutes later, I returned home sweaty and satisfied.
